23 years on road with 260,000 miles on my 2002 Sentra is still running very well. Rust has weakened the body, but everything except for the alternator, struts and control arms are original. I just had Missouri safety inspection and was told that car won’t pass next inspection in two years because of the rust weakening the suspension and body mating points. 2002 Sentra GXE has been an amazing car. Hope that new ones are as reliable as the old ones.
